Output e85a542e7fcc1b8b4d8d188eba6660463a0ace159ee5ea0d45f2bee4c23aceb0: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f27cfd89f73cf36a2a8bc9205c1b5a9d179b2a5 OP_EQUAL
address
3DHMS5ukpuvyeugmfjMV7G81uFkUqdYGQL
transaction
e85a542e7fcc1b8b4d8d188eba6660463a0ace159ee5ea0d45f2bee4c23aceb0
spent
true